📺 What Is the Current Landscape of Streaming Video Services?

The modern streaming environment is highly fragmented, with major media conglomerates pulling their content back onto proprietary platforms. This means viewers must carefully evaluate which services actually deliver the specific library of movies, live sports, and original series they want. The days of finding everything on a single platform are long gone, replaced by a complex ecosystem of exclusive rights and geographic licensing restrictions.

Service TypePrice RangeBest ForResolution Options
Premium On-Demand$6.99 - $22.99/moOriginal dramas, movies, and exclusive seriesHD, 4K UHD, HDR
Live TV Replacements$40.00 - $85.00/moLive sports, local news, and cable channels720p, 1080p, 4K
Ad-Supported Free (FAST)FreeClassic television, indie movies, and background viewing720p, 1080p

Anúncios

Understanding these basic categories helps you avoid the common trap of paying for premium features when a budget tier or even a free, ad-supported service would easily satisfy your daily entertainment needs. For instance, if you primarily watch classic sitcoms or background television while cooking, a free ad-supported streaming television (FAST) channel might completely eliminate the need for an active monthly subscription on a premium platform.

⚠️ What Are the Biggest Downsides of Streaming Video Services?

While cutting the cord offers incredible freedom, the modern streaming landscape has several distinct disadvantages that consumers must navigate. Being aware of these pitfalls prevents you from wasting money on platforms that do not fit your lifestyle or your home technology setup.

  • Subscription Creep: Signing up for multiple niche platforms can quickly result in a monthly bill that exceeds your old cable package, especially when you forget to cancel services after a specific series ends.
  • Content Rotation: Licensing agreements mean that your favorite movies and classic television shows can disappear from a platform without warning, leaving you mid-season without a way to finish your favorite show.
  • Ad-Tier Intrusion: Budget-friendly tiers are increasingly filled with repetitive, unskippable commercial breaks that disrupt the immersive viewing experience, sometimes showing the exact same ad multiple times per episode.
  • Device Compatibility: Certain older smart televisions or budget streaming sticks may not support the latest updates, causing apps to lag, crash, or fail to load specific high-definition streams entirely.
  • Data Cap Issues: Streaming high-definition or 4K content continuously can quickly exhaust your home internet plan's monthly data allowance, leading to unexpected overage fees from your internet service provider.

Carefully evaluating these potential downsides before entering your credit card information will keep you from feeling frustrated by sudden price hikes or missing content. It also helps to regularly audit your home internet plan to ensure it can handle the heavy data demands of multiple simultaneous high-definition streams.

🚀 How Do You Set Up Your Perfect Streaming Ecosystem?

Getting started with a new streaming video service is a straightforward process, but taking a few deliberate steps will ensure you get the best possible deal, the highest viewing quality, and absolute control over your monthly spending.

  1. Audit Your Internet Speed: Run a quick online speed test to confirm your home Wi-Fi can comfortably support high-definition streaming on multiple household devices. Aim for at least 25 Mbps for stable 4K playback.
  2. Select Your Media Player: Choose a reliable smart TV interface or external streaming stick that supports all the major applications you plan to use, ensuring it has a fast processor and an intuitive remote control.
  3. Sign Up for Free Trials: Take advantage of promotional trial periods to test the platform's user interface, search functionality, and content library before committing to a recurring monthly bill.
  4. Configure Parental Controls: Set up individual profiles for each family member immediately and establish secure PIN codes to keep young children from accessing mature content or making unauthorized purchases.
  5. Adjust Video Quality Settings: If your home internet has strict monthly data limits, lower the default streaming resolution inside the app settings from 4K to 1080p to save significant amounts of bandwidth.
  6. Review Your Subscriptions Monthly: Set a recurring calendar reminder to cancel any platform you have not watched in the last thirty days, keeping your active subscriptions lean and highly relevant.

Following this systematic setup process keeps your digital entertainment organized, highly cost-effective, and perfectly tailored to your household's actual viewing preferences. It prevents the common frustration of paying for high-tier plans when your hardware or network cannot even support those premium features.

❓ Frequently Asked Questions About Streaming Media

What internet speed do I need for 4K streaming?
To stream content in crisp 4K Ultra HD resolution, you generally need a stable internet connection speed of at least 25 Mbps per active device. If multiple people in your household are streaming, gaming, or working simultaneously, a total home bandwidth of 100 Mbps or higher is highly recommended to prevent buffering.
Can I share my streaming accounts with family members?
Most major platforms now restrict account sharing outside of your primary physical household. They use IP addresses, device IDs, and Wi-Fi network data to enforce these rules. You should check each service's specific household location policies to avoid account suspension or extra member fees.
How do I easily cancel a streaming subscription?
You can cancel your subscription by logging into the platform's website via a web browser, navigating to your account settings, and selecting the billing or cancel option. If you signed up through an app store (like Apple or Google Play), you must manage and cancel the subscription directly through your mobile device's subscription settings.
Are free streaming services actually safe to use?
Yes, legitimate, ad-supported free services (FAST platforms) are entirely safe and legal. They generate revenue through standard commercial breaks rather than charging you subscription fees. Always stick to well-known, verified apps on your smart TV store to avoid malicious websites or illegal pirated streams.
